
Responsibilities:
Responsible for the retention, satisfaction, and growth of clients within their assigned book. Book of business includes mid-size plans with higher complexity, with most significant opportunities within asset range for Client Lifetime Value growth across Recordkeeping, Advice, and I/O.
Develops and communicates strategic business plans for current clients within assigned book of business (e.g., Miller Heiman gold sheets). Implements long term relationship retention & growth strategies.
Strategically navigates client organizations to evaluate needs and position Vanguard IIG services, solutions, and products to solve their needs.
Leads and executes on RFP and re-bid processes
Achieves established sales, satisfaction and retention goals through personal direction of all executive and staff level activities of the sales process.
Coaches internal teams towards achieving book of business strategy, shares best practices and learnings.
Facilitates strong business support by working with team members to promote a consistent approach to decisions and client/prospect propositions. Drives connection across all appropriate internal and external stakeholders. Influences and collaborates with divisional business partners to offer and dedicate the right SMEs and resources when appropriate.
Diligently leverages and reinforces the client support structure to maximize the CSE’s time for clients.
Coaches, collaborates, and provides insight and direction to less experienced sales executives and internal partners.
Travel requirement: Up to 50% - west coast territory
Participates in special projects and performs other duties as assigned.
Qualifications:
Five years financial services experience with at least three years in a senior level client or prospect relationship role.
Undergraduate degree or equivalent combination of training and experience. Graduate degree preferred.
This job requires a regulatory license and/or registration (e.g. FINRA, state, SFC). In particular, required are Series 6 and Series 63. These licenses are preferred pre-hire, but we are willing to assist in obtaining within 90 days of hire.
This role requires one to come onsite to our Scottsdale office every Tuesday, Wednesday and Thursday.
